
Aaron Leventhal named Thunder strength coach
May 8, 2006 - USL First Division (USL-1)
Minnesota Thunder News Release
ST. PAUL, Minn. (Monday, May 8, 2006)--The Minnesota Thunder has named Aaron Leventhal as the team's strength and conditioning coach. Leventhal, a former Thunder player, will be responsible for the conditioning of the team in the off-season as well as during the season. Leventhal will also run the Thunder camp recently renamed the Jostens High School Prep Camp in August, which will focus on preparing high school soccer players for their fall seasons. He will also be spending time with the new women's premier soccer team, the Minnesota Lightning.
"We have already made great progress this season," said Leventhal. "I'm looking forward to both building the physical attributes of the Thunder as well as maintaining their level of fitness through a grueling five month season."
Aaron Leventhal played for the Thunder from 1992-2001. He retired in 2002 to open Aaron Leventhal Training Studios in Minneapolis. Leventhal is certified as an NSCA trainer and holds certifications in Pilates, N-stretch, and Reactive Neuromuscular Training. His clients include US Olympic skier Kristina Koznick, Survivor Africa winner Ethan Zohn and professional golfer, Kris Lindstrom. He also currently works with over 100 skiers and soccer players participating in Olympic development programs.
"I have worked with several strength coaches in my 15 year professional career," said Thunder Coach Amos Magee. "The work Aaron does with our players is far and away the hardest, most demanding and best of any of them. Utilizing coach Leventhal, we will undoubtedly be among the fittest and most athletic teams in the USL."
Aaron Leventhal is currently running an Elite Prep Training Program designed for high level athletes of all competitive sports. The Jostens High School Prep Camp August 7-11 in St. Paul will focus on preparing high school soccer players for their fall seasons through a combination of strength, conditioning and technical work specific to soccer.
